COOLEY RESERVOII2 AND FULTON WILDLIFE AREA PIT <br />AMENDMENT NO. 1 - JERONIMUS PROPERTY <br />EXHIBIT E -RECLAMATION PLAN <br />This area of Amendment No. 1 is expected to be the final phase of the operation, and is intended to <br />preserve existing open space/wildlife preserve areas in their natural state and create new open <br />space/wildlife preserve areas. Areas that are not mined or disturbed will be left "as is". These areas <br />will not be regraded or revegetated, but instead be preserved in their existing state. Within 1 year <br />after all mining is completed, all disturbed areas and reclaimed slopes above those areas proposed for <br />wetlands establishment shall be covered with 6"-12" + of topsoil prior to seeding. Any hard packed <br />areas shall be scarified prior to the placement of topsoil and seeding. After backfilling, g.*ading of any <br />area to final slopes, and placement of topsoil, seeding will be initiated as soon as possible. Maximum <br />steepness of all slopes shall be 3H to 1 V. <br />After placement of stored topsoil, areas not proposed for wetland revegetation areas shall be <br />revegetated with non-irrigated grasses per the Cooley Reservoir Mix B from NRCS 01/28/03 letter <br />to create uplands copied in EXHIBIT J -VEGETATION INFORMATION. This grass seeding shall <br />consist of the following: <br />SPECIES VARIETY PLS# PERCENT PLS#/AC <br />Pubescent wheatgrass Luna 9.0 20.0 I.8 <br />Western wheatgrass Arriba or Barton 8.0 30.0 2.4 <br />Blue grama Hachita or Covington 1.5 10.0 0.2 <br />Sideoats grama Vaughn or Butte 4.5 30.0 1.4 <br />For wetlands creation, partial reclamation will begin with the backfilling of sediments created during <br />the processing of the mined sand and gravel. At the termination of mining, at least 50% of the <br />presently exposed lake area is expected to been bac~lled to a level to support wetland vegetation <br />at the conclusion of all mining. Interim planting of wetlands vegetation shall be undertaken, whenever <br />a minimum of 5 acres has been filled to within 3' to 5' above the original lake surface. Created <br />wetlands in excess of what is required to be created per an approved Corp of Engineer's 404 Permit <br />on this property may be utilized as replacement wetlands on others sites in accordance with approved <br />Corp of Engineer's 404 permits on other sites. <br />
